I want to make a cake with a rotating carousel topper. I have found several carousel cakes on Instagram, but I particular like this one: https://www.instagram.com/p/DJJaqiFzBnf/
I like the way the carousel rotates from the top instead of the bottom. I asked the cake artist what she used and she said she used a machine that has a center rod in it that connects to the top. I did not follow up and ask her the name of it because I feel like if she knew, she would have told me. I have no idea what this is. Does anyone know? I had considered using a rotating jewelry stand, but I am worried that since it would rotate from the bottom, it might not rotate if I put too much weight on it. Thank you.

I don't know how they did it but I know I could cobble one together without too much trouble.
Put a battery carousel inside a cake stand, insert a rod into the spinning plate through the cake, 1/2 dowel would work, you just need a way to fix the rod to the plate that holds alignment and can be taken apart.
